UNION 查詢選修了180101號或180102號課程或二者都選修了的學生學號、課程號和成績。 (SELECT 學號, 課程號, 成績 FROM 學習 WHERE 課程號='180101') UNION (SELECT 學號, 課程號, 成績 FROM 學習 ...
SQL語句中的三個關鍵字:MINUS 減去 ,INTERSECT 交集 和UNION ALL 並集 關於集合的概念,中學都應該學過,就不多說了.這三個關鍵字主要是對數據庫的查詢結果進行操作,正如其中文含義一樣:兩個查詢,MINUS是從第一 個查詢結果減去第二個查詢結果,如果有相交部分就減去相交部分 否則和第一個查詢結果沒有區別.INTERSECT是兩個查詢結果的交集,UNION ALL是兩個查詢 ...
2016-09-09 19:54 0 7555 推薦指數:
UNION 查詢選修了180101號或180102號課程或二者都選修了的學生學號、課程號和成績。 (SELECT 學號, 課程號, 成績 FROM 學習 WHERE 課程號='180101') UNION (SELECT 學號, 課程號, 成績 FROM 學習 ...
創建表並添加數據: intersect: 返回查詢結果中相同的部分(交集)。 union,union all: 將查詢的結果組合后返回, union會過濾重復,union all不過濾重復。 minus: 返回在第一個 ...
UNION用的比較多union all是直接連接,取到得是所有值,記錄可能有重復 union 是取唯一值,記錄沒有重復 1、UNION 的語法如下: [SQL 語句 1] UNION [SQL 語句 2]2、UNION ALL 的語法如下: [SQL 語句 ...
Union All/Union/Intersect操作 適用場景:對兩個集合的處理,例如追加、合並、取相同項、相交項等等。 Concat(連接) 說明:連接不同的集合,不會自動過濾相同項;延遲。 1.簡單形式: var q = ( from c in db.Customers ...
看到一篇文章是講sql語句or與union all的執行效率比較的,以前沒怎么注意這個問題,感覺文章寫的不錯,轉來一看。 文章原鏈接:http://www.cunyoulu.com/zhuanti/qtstudy/20081124orunion.htm sql語句or與union all ...
最近做的一個財物管理系統中查詢過期或逾期的存儲過程,返回 “財物所屬的案件名稱”,“財物名稱”,“財物編號”,“ 過期或逾期時間 ”(超期或逾期前7天開始預警)。 遇到“ union all 內不能使用 order ...
整理別人的sql大概的思想是用union 和union all --合並重復行select * from Aunion select * from B--不合並重復行select * from Aunion allselect * from B按某個字段排序--合並重復行select *from ...
說明: 1.CAST (expression AS data_type)字段類型轉換函數 2.UNION和UNION all 多表合並函數 問題: 1.兩表字段類型不一致 用cast或concat函數解決 2.兩表列屬性數量不一致問題 select后跟相同 ...